Your tour begins with a warm welcome from your guide at Largo Del Colonnato Square, conveniently located in the heart of the Vatican City.
1st level of St. Peter's Dome
Step out of the elevator on the dome’s lower level to witness elaborate mosaics and architectural details, as dreamed up by Michelangelo.
Top of the St. Peter's Dome
Climb 320 steps to the very top of the dome, where you’ll be rewarded with a view of the Vatican that has inspired pilgrims and poets alike.
St. Peter's Basilica
Return to the ground level to discover its opulent decorations, stunning marble statues, and gold accents that reflect its sacred status.
La Pietá
Carved from a single block of Carrara marble, this masterpiece showcases Michelangelo's skill in capturing human emotion and divine beauty.

Meet your guide at Largo Del Colonnato. This is the area just outside of the St. Peters Square colonnades, on the right side if you’re looking at St. Peter’s Basilica. You’ll see a friendly representative holding a “The Tour Guy” sign standing between the fountain and the green kiosk.

Met for earliest tour in morning. By the time the group was ready had to wait in a longer line for entrance. Tour guide had pretty surficial knowledge. Could have learned as much from Wikipedia page. Guide didn’t accompany to top of Dome or into Basilica, which technically might not have been allowed, but plenty of other guides were doing it. By the time Dome climb was done the Basilica was packed. Wish we had got there at same time on our own, done the Basilica, then the Dome, and saved money. Basically, the guide was valuable for steering us in right direction.
